At the scale of tiny explorers, the immersive installation Knuet is a soft, sensory playground made entirely of ropes. Children enter a world where ropes connect people and objects, strings become curtains, and cords transform into ladders and swings, inviting little ones to climb, crawl, and create.

Guided by three performers, children are free to explore sounds, textures, and movement at their own pace. A soothing and imaginative experience for the very young – and their grown-ups.
